Cranberry
CranberrySU


in Scribblenauts Unlimited

Type

Food, Fruit and Veg, Sweet

Behavior

Makes juice with a blender.

Synonyms

Barberry, Bayberry, Bearberry, Black Currant, Bocksdorn, Buffaloberry, Bull Berry, Cherry Alder, Cherry Satinash, Christmas Berry, Yamamomo, Yangmei, Yumberry

Available in

Scribblenauts, Super Scribblenauts, Scribblenauts Remix, Scribblenauts Unlimited, Scribblenauts Unmasked, Scribblenauts Showdown, Scribblenauts Mega Pack

A Cranberry is a very tart red berry used for sauce or juice. The tartness of the cranberry make it one of the few berries never to be eaten raw. Their flavor is enhanced when combined with sweet ingredients and when paired with other fruits like apples, pears, and oranges. This makes them an ideal ingredient in desserts.

Put the cranberry in a blender and interact with it, and you get juice!
